China Warns of National Security Risks Linked to Worldcoin’s Biometric Data Collection Efforts

Main Idea
China's Ministry of State Security warns against crypto projects collecting biometric data, citing national security risks and urging public vigilance, with Worldcoin being a notable example.
Key Points
1. China’s Ministry of State Security has issued a warning against crypto projects that collect biometric data, emphasizing potential national security risks.
2. Worldcoin, a project that collects biometric data to differentiate humans from AI, is highlighted as a concern due to these risks.
3. Worldcoin has faced bans in several countries, including Kenya, Brazil, Spain, Portugal, and Hong Kong, due to its biometric data collection practices.
4. China’s warning urges the public to be vigilant against suspicious operations involving biometric data collection by crypto projects.
